博客 实时数据融合与渲染技术的高效实现方法

实时数据融合与渲染技术的高效实现方法

   数栈君   发表于 2026-01-10 14:32  83  0

在当今数字化转型的浪潮中,实时数据融合与渲染技术已成为企业构建数据中台、数字孪生和数字可视化应用的核心技术之一。通过高效地整合和处理实时数据,并将其转化为直观的可视化呈现,企业能够快速做出决策,提升运营效率。本文将深入探讨实时数据融合与渲染技术的实现方法,并为企业提供实用的建议。


什么是实时数据融合与渲染技术?

实时数据融合与渲染技术是指将来自多个数据源的实时数据进行整合、处理,并通过渲染引擎将其转化为动态、交互式的可视化界面。这一技术广泛应用于数据中台、数字孪生、实时监控等领域,帮助企业从海量数据中提取有价值的信息。

1. 实时数据融合的重要性

实时数据融合的核心在于将来自不同系统、设备和传感器的实时数据进行清洗、转换和整合。例如,在智慧城市中,实时数据可能来自交通摄像头、气象传感器、移动设备等多种来源。通过数据融合,企业可以消除数据孤岛,形成统一的数据视图,从而支持更高效的决策。

  • 数据清洗:去除噪声数据,确保数据的准确性和一致性。
  • 数据转换:将不同格式的数据转换为统一格式,便于后续处理。
  • 数据关联:通过时间戳、地理位置等信息,将相关数据进行关联,形成完整的数据链条。

2. 渲染技术的作用

渲染技术是将数据转化为可视化界面的关键步骤。通过渲染引擎,企业可以将抽象的数据转化为图表、3D模型、动态地图等形式,使用户能够直观地理解和分析数据。

  • 动态更新:实时数据的动态更新需要渲染引擎具备高效的刷新机制,确保界面的实时性。
  • 交互性:用户可以通过交互操作(如缩放、旋转、筛选)与可视化界面进行互动,进一步挖掘数据价值。
  • 多维度呈现:支持多种可视化形式(如2D/3D图表、热力图、地理信息系统等),满足不同场景的需求。

高效实现实时数据融合与渲染的步骤

为了实现高效的实时数据融合与渲染,企业需要从数据采集、处理、存储到渲染的整个流程进行全面优化。以下是具体的实现步骤:

1. 数据采集与预处理

数据采集是实时数据融合的第一步。企业需要从多种数据源(如传感器、数据库、API接口等)获取实时数据,并进行初步的预处理。

  • 多源数据采集:支持多种数据格式(如JSON、CSV、数据库表等)和多种传输协议(如HTTP、MQTT、TCP/IP等)。
  • 数据清洗:在采集阶段对数据进行初步清洗,去除无效数据和噪声。
  • 数据缓存:对于延迟较高的数据源,可以采用缓存机制,确保数据的实时性。

2. 数据融合与计算

数据融合是实时数据处理的核心环节。企业需要将来自不同数据源的数据进行整合,并通过计算生成新的数据视图。

  • 分布式计算框架:采用分布式计算框架(如Apache Flink、Apache Spark Streaming)处理大规模实时数据,确保高吞吐量和低延迟。
  • 流数据处理:对实时流数据进行处理,支持事件时间、水印等机制,确保数据的准确性和一致性。
  • 数据关联与聚合:通过时间戳、地理位置等信息,将相关数据进行关联,并进行聚合计算(如求和、平均值等)。

3. 数据存储与管理

实时数据融合与渲染需要高效的存储和管理机制,以支持快速的数据访问和更新。

  • 实时数据库:采用实时数据库(如InfluxDB、TimescaleDB)存储实时数据,支持高效的插入和查询操作。
  • 分布式存储:对于大规模数据,采用分布式存储方案(如Hadoop HDFS、阿里云OSS)确保数据的高可用性和可扩展性。
  • 数据索引:通过构建索引(如时间戳索引、地理位置索引)提高数据查询效率。

4. 渲染引擎的选择与优化

渲染引擎是实时数据渲染的核心工具。企业需要选择合适的渲染引擎,并对其进行优化,以确保渲染效果和性能。

  • 渲染引擎选择:根据应用场景选择合适的渲染引擎。例如,对于2D可视化,可以选择D3.js、ECharts;对于3D可视化,可以选择Three.js、Cesium.js。
  • 渲染性能优化:通过减少不必要的渲染操作、优化数据结构、使用硬件加速等方法,提高渲染性能。
  • 动态更新优化:通过缓存机制、增量更新等方法,减少渲染引擎的负载,提高渲染效率。

5. 边缘计算与渲染的结合

为了进一步提升实时数据融合与渲染的效率,企业可以结合边缘计算技术。

  • 边缘计算的优势:将数据处理和渲染任务部署在靠近数据源的边缘设备上,减少数据传输延迟。
  • 边缘渲染:在边缘设备上进行实时渲染,通过5G网络将渲染结果传输到中心平台或用户终端,提升用户体验。

实时数据融合与渲染技术的应用场景

实时数据融合与渲染技术在多个领域都有广泛的应用,以下是几个典型场景:

1. 智慧城市

在智慧城市中,实时数据融合与渲染技术可以用于交通管理、环境监测、公共安全等领域。

  • 交通管理:通过实时数据融合,整合交通摄像头、传感器、车辆位置等数据,生成动态交通地图,帮助交通管理部门优化交通流量。
  • 环境监测:通过实时数据融合,整合空气质量、气象数据等信息,生成动态环境地图,帮助环保部门及时发现和处理环境问题。

2. 工业互联网

在工业互联网中,实时数据融合与渲染技术可以用于设备监控、生产优化、故障预测等领域。

  • 设备监控:通过实时数据融合,整合设备传感器数据、生产数据等信息,生成动态设备监控界面,帮助运维人员实时监控设备状态。
  • 生产优化:通过实时数据融合,整合生产数据、设备状态数据等信息,生成动态生产优化建议,帮助生产企业提高效率。

3. 金融实时监控

在金融领域,实时数据融合与渲染技术可以用于实时行情监控、风险控制、交易决策等领域。

  • 实时行情监控:通过实时数据融合,整合股票、期货、外汇等市场数据,生成动态行情界面,帮助交易员快速做出交易决策。
  • 风险控制:通过实时数据融合,整合市场数据、交易数据等信息,生成动态风险评估界面,帮助风控部门及时发现和处理风险。

实时数据融合与渲染技术的挑战与解决方案

尽管实时数据融合与渲染技术具有诸多优势,但在实际应用中仍面临一些挑战。

1. 数据源多样性

企业可能需要从多种数据源获取实时数据,包括传感器、数据库、API接口等。不同数据源的数据格式、传输协议、时延等可能各不相同,增加了数据融合的复杂性。

解决方案:采用支持多源数据采集和多协议传输的数据采集工具,如Apache Kafka、RabbitMQ等。

2. 数据延迟

实时数据融合与渲染技术需要处理大规模实时数据,可能会面临数据延迟的问题。

解决方案:采用分布式计算框架(如Apache Flink、Apache Spark Streaming)处理实时数据,确保高吞吐量和低延迟。

3. 带宽限制

在一些应用场景中,网络带宽可能有限,影响数据传输和渲染效果。

解决方案:采用数据压缩算法(如Gzip、Snappy)压缩数据,减少数据传输量;同时,采用边缘计算技术,将数据处理和渲染任务部署在靠近数据源的边缘设备上,减少数据传输延迟。

4. 渲染性能

对于大规模数据,渲染引擎可能会面临性能瓶颈,影响用户体验。

解决方案:通过优化渲染引擎、减少不必要的渲染操作、使用硬件加速等方法,提高渲染性能。


如何选择合适的实时数据融合与渲染技术?

企业在选择实时数据融合与渲染技术时,需要考虑以下几个因素:

1. 数据规模

企业需要根据自身的数据规模选择合适的技术方案。对于小规模数据,可以选择轻量级的解决方案;对于大规模数据,需要选择分布式计算框架。

2. 实时性要求

企业需要根据自身的实时性要求选择合适的技术方案。对于高实时性要求的应用场景,需要选择低延迟、高吞吐量的解决方案。

3. 可扩展性

企业需要根据自身的业务需求选择可扩展的技术方案。对于未来业务扩展,需要选择支持可扩展性的解决方案。

4. 成本

企业需要根据自身的预算选择合适的技术方案。对于预算有限的企业,可以选择开源技术;对于预算充足的企业,可以选择商业解决方案。


结语

实时数据融合与渲染技术是企业构建数据中台、数字孪生和数字可视化应用的核心技术之一。通过高效地整合和处理实时数据,并将其转化为直观的可视化界面,企业能够快速做出决策,提升运营效率。在选择实时数据融合与渲染技术时,企业需要综合考虑数据规模、实时性要求、可扩展性和成本等因素,选择合适的解决方案。

如果您对实时数据融合与渲染技术感兴趣,可以申请试用相关工具,了解更多详细信息:申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料